Tools to Help You Succeed
We understand that stepping into the role of a director can be both exciting and daunting. That’s why we provide resources designed to support you along the way:
Director’s Guidebook – A comprehensive resource covering essential directing techniques, staging, and best practices to help you bring your vision to life.
Creative Worksheets – Thought-provoking exercises that assist with character development, blocking ideas, and overall storytelling strategies.
Mentorship and Support – Guidance from experienced directors from ART who can offer insight, answer questions, and help you navigate the challenges of directing.
Opportunities for Emerging Directors
If you’ve ever considered directing but weren’t sure where to start, now is the perfect time to take that leap. Adirondack Regional Theatre welcomes passionate individuals who want to test their directing skills in a supportive, community-driven atmosphere. Whether you wish to direct a pick up play, assist with a larger production, or helm an entire show, we have opportunities tailored to your level of experience. Our Green Directors Series is the perfect opportunity for adult directors looking to cultivate their craft and work with a young director, aged 14-18, to create an amazing show for a cast of kids, 8-18.
